Output d3a28bf1db4e981c7fc16607c749c8cc5e2df32907368d0e4dc45f31bb9fa0a2:0

value
38085989
script pubkey
OP_0 OP_PUSHBYTES_20 6d52294a26da3645fc24060bf4567c034db75b59
address
bc1qd4fzjj3xmgmytlpyqc9lg4nuqdxmwk6erlkl47
transaction
d3a28bf1db4e981c7fc16607c749c8cc5e2df32907368d0e4dc45f31bb9fa0a2
confirmations
181552
spent
true